Abstract: | ![]() The model of the Γ-ray burst is developed which is based on the nuclear explosion in the neutron star envelope because of the chain fission reaction of the superheavy nuclei. It is shown, that the main part of the Γ-ray burst radiation must have thermal origin, but the nonthermal component and Γ-ray lines may be present. The parameters of the strong burst of 5 March 1979 are evaluated on the basis of its radiation spectra and the present model. The distance to this burst is about 100 pc and the total energy of this Γ-ray burst is about 2.1039 ergs. |
